Really enjoyed coming to this park with the family. A short hike that’s worth it at the end with a lake view. Plan for 1-2 hrs here. Lots of vineyards to see on your way up there. There are quite a few mountain bikers , so keep that in mind of having to move often to the side for them .
This place is pretty amazing. Lots of little adventures to find. A secret cave with an amazing little view. Several different trails, each with their own different view of the surrounding area. Dogs are allowed on a leash. I saw a couple of ponds when I was there they had some ducks in them. There were also several children running around exploring and enjoying themselves, so it seems like a pretty family friendly place to go. There were several picnic tables in shaded areas disbursed throughout the park incase you wanted to snack or some lunch. It can get pretty crowded so get there early plus the parking lot is super small and they charge like a four dollar fee but don’t worry there’s parking along the road just outside the park. I was lucky enough to get a spot in the shade there pretty lucky. So if you don’t park in the parking lot and you save yourself the fee, why not just drop it in the donation box on your way into the park. ENJOY!

Lovely local park for day hikes. Multiple species of wildflowers in the spring. $3 entrance fee; extra $1 for dog. Bikes are also allowed. Scenic oakwood meadows make for good scenery as well as some locations with elevated views of the surrounding areas. There is a mix of wooded areas as well. If you are trying to get a closer look at a flower, be sure to check for poison oak first.
